ABSTRACT

This chapter lays the foundation for the book. First, the chapter briefly introduces socially sustainable business systems (SSBS) as a new way of establishing a system of business practices, business policies, and business regulation in such a way as to assure the sustainability of the planet and all of its inhabitants. The chapter then examines the intellectual foundation of capitalism and the current form of destructive advanced capitalism (DAC), including Adam Smith and the Chicago School of economic thought. The chapter then analyzes, at macro level, the current model of DAC and its problematic impacts on the planet and the people (poverty and inequality, consumers, communities, creativity, and democracy). The chapter then discusses the structure of the remaining chapters of the book.
